Weaving Creativity into Daily Life: 5 Essential Tips

  • I’ve found that starting small is key – dedicating just 10-15 minutes a day to a creative pursuit can be incredibly powerful, whether it’s writing, drawing, or photography
  • Experimenting with different mediums and forms of expression can help you uncover hidden talents and interests, from painting to playing an instrument or even urban photography
  • Schedule creativity into your daily planner, just as you would any other important appointment, to ensure it becomes a consistent and valued part of your routine
  • Embracing imperfection is crucial – remember, the goal of a daily creative practice isn’t to produce a masterpiece, but to cultivate mindfulness, self-expression, and joy
  • Making your creative practice a sensory experience can deepen its impact – try listening to music, sipping a favorite tea, or working in a space filled with natural light to enhance your creative time

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I incorporate a daily creative practice into my already busy schedule?

For me, it’s about sneaking in tiny pockets of creativity wherever I can – like jotting down poetry on my morning commute or snapping photos of street art during my lunch break. Even 10-15 minutes of creative expression can be a powerful catalyst for inspiration and calm in an otherwise hectic day.

What if I don't feel like I'm 'good' at a particular creative activity – can I still benefit from doing it daily?

The beauty of daily creativity lies not in mastery, but in the act itself. I’ve found that showing up, imperfectly, to my journal or canvas is where the real growth happens – it’s about embracing the process, not the product, and letting go of self-criticism to uncover the joy in creation.

Can a daily creative practice really help with stress and anxiety, or is that just a myth?

For me, a daily creative practice has been a game-changer in managing stress and anxiety – it’s not just a myth. Through journaling, painting, or even just doodling, I’ve found that creative expression can be a powerful release, allowing me to process emotions and calm my mind in a way that feels truly therapeutic.
